CSS是一種常用的網(wǎng)頁樣式設(shè)計(jì)語言,在網(wǎng)頁設(shè)計(jì)中經(jīng)常使用。CSS不僅可以設(shè)置網(wǎng)頁的背景顏色、字體大小等樣式屬性,還可以設(shè)置網(wǎng)頁文字排版。
在CSS中,我們可以使用transform屬性來設(shè)置豎行文字。如果要讓文字豎直排列,可以使用以下代碼:
pre {
writing-mode: vertical-lr;
}
上面的代碼中,writing-mode屬性設(shè)置為vertical-lr,意思是豎直排列,并且文字從上到下排列(lr為left to right的縮寫,表示從左到右)。
此外,我們還可以使用text-orientation屬性來設(shè)置豎行文字的方向。如果要讓文字從右向左排列,可以使用以下代碼:
pre {
writing-mode: vertical-lr;
text-orientation: upright;
}
上面的代碼中,text-orientation屬性設(shè)置為upright,表示豎行文字方向?yàn)檎ⅰ?
除了pre標(biāo)簽外,我們還可以在p標(biāo)簽中使用上述代碼來設(shè)置豎行文字。例如:
這是豎列文字的例子
.vertical-text { writing-mode: vertical-lr; text-orientation: upright; } 上面的代碼中,我們使用了類選擇器來為p標(biāo)簽設(shè)置豎列文字樣式。 通過使用CSS的transform屬性和text-orientation屬性,我們可以輕松地設(shè)置網(wǎng)頁中的豎行文字。無論是在文本排版還是設(shè)計(jì)排版方面,都有著廣泛的應(yīng)用。